What Causes Eye Strain?
Eye strain, also known as asthenopia, can result from several factors:
- Extended Screen Time: Staring at screens for too long without breaks can tire the eye muscles.
- Poor Lighting: Insufficient or harsh lighting can aggravate eye discomfort.
- Improper Monitor Setup: Incorrect monitor distance and angle can put additional strain on your eyes.
- Uncorrected Vision Problems: Pre-existing vision issues can worsen with screen use.

The Science of Blue Light
Blue light is part of the visible light spectrum and has wavelengths ranging from 380 to 500 nanometers. As screens emit a high level of blue light, understanding its effects is essential:
-
Melatonin Suppression: Exposure to blue light, especially before bedtime, can disrupt melatonin production, impacting sleep quality.
-
Potential Eye Damage: Some studies suggest that prolonged exposure to blue light may lead to retinal damage over time, although more research is needed in this area.
Research Findings on Computer Glasses
While many users report relief from symptoms when using computer glasses, scientific studies have provided mixed results:
-
Reduction in Eye Strain: Some studies indicate that blue light-blocking glasses can reduce eye strain, fatigue, and discomfort after long hours of screen use.
-
Placebo Effect: The psychological aspect cannot be overlooked; if individuals believe that their glasses will help, they may experience less discomfort simply due to their expectations.

Additional Tips for Reducing Eye Strain
In addition to using computer glasses, other strategies can help minimize eye strain:
-
The 20-20-20 Rule: Every 20 minutes, take a 20-second break and look at something 20 feet away. This helps relax the eye muscles.
-
Adjust Screen Settings: Increasing text size and adjusting brightness can reduce strain.
-
Maintain Proper Posture: Sit at an appropriate distance from the screen, usually around 20 to 30 inches, and ensure the screen is at eye level.
